Workshop: Co-processing of alternative fuels and raw materials in the Vietnamese cement industry

9:00 - 12:30 29/09/2022 Offline Vietnamese & English Address: Melia Hotel Hanoi

A regional project called OPTOCE (Ocean Plastics Turned into an Opportunity in Circular Economy) investigates how the involvement of the Cement Industry can increase the treatment capacity for Non-Recyclable Plastic Wastes in China, India, Myanmar, Thailand, and Vietnam and thereby contribute to reduce the release of plastics to the Sea. The half-day workshop aims to share international experiences with Co-processing of wastes in the cement industry, to share the results of the recent Pilot test with Non-Recyclable Plastic Wastes at the INSEE plant in Hon Chong, and to discuss the potential for future co-processing in the Vietnamese cement industry.
